Can I work in USA as a Canadian citizen?

Is it possible for a Canadian to work in the United States? Canadian citizens are permitted to work in the United States in the same way that any other foreign individual is permitted to do so. However, before they may legally work in the United States or accept a job offer, they must first get a work visa from the Department of State in the United States.

How can I work in USA without work permit?

Only persons with green cards, U.S. citizenship, or certain types of work visas will be able to take employment in the United States without first obtaining an EAD (employment authorization document). And only a few categories of people will be eligible for an EAD.

Can I move to America without a job?

No, you cannot relocate to the United States unless you have a job lined up. The only legal methods to immigrate to the United States are through family reunification, job, investment, or student exchange programs, all of which include having a visa in hand before to traveling to the United States.

Do I lose my Canadian citizenship if I become an American?

If a Canadian chooses to choose another nationality or a number of other nations, they will not lose their citizenship. In the event that they are naturalized as citizens, they will keep both their original citizenship as well as their Canadian citizenship, assuming that the other nation likewise recognizes dual citizenship.
